Far Infrared Carbon Heaters

Carbon panel heaters distribute far infrared heat evenly across the full cabin surface, operating at wavelengths of 7 to 14 microns that correspond closely to the bodys own thermal emission range, producing a deep, penetrating warmth at air temperatures as low as 45 degrees Celsius.

Canadian Hemlock Construction

PEFC-certified Canadian hemlock is the benchmark timber for premium sauna construction — its straight, close grain resists warping under repeated heat and humidity cycles, its naturally low resin content prevents surface tackiness at elevated temperatures, and its antimicrobial properties keep the interior hygienic between sessions.

Digital Control Panel

The integrated digital control panel lets you pre-set the cabin temperature up to 65 degrees Celsius, schedule a session timer from 1 to 60 minutes, and control interior chromotherapy lighting — all from inside or outside the cabin via the interior duplicate panel, ensuring complete convenience throughout every session.

Practical installation and space guidance for your infrared sauna Glasgow

Installing a home infrared sauna Glasgow is significantly more straightforward than many buyers expect. Because the heaters draw a maximum of 2000W — within the capacity of a standard 13-amp domestic socket — there is no requirement for a dedicated circuit, no need to contact an electrician for a new circuit installation, and no consumer unit upgrade in the vast majority of Scottish homes. For a one-person cabin you will need a floor footprint of approximately 100 cm by 100 cm plus 60 cm clearance on at least one side for the door swing and ventilation airflow. Ceiling height should be a minimum of 200 cm. The cabin can be positioned on any level, dry surface including timber flooring, tile, or concrete — no special sub-floor preparation is required. Passive ventilation through the cabin vents is sufficient; no mechanical extraction ducting is needed. For outdoor installations in a Glasgow garden, our weatherproofed outdoor cabins are purpose-designed for the Scottish climate.

We recommend placing your infrared sauna in a room with a minimum ambient temperature of 10 degrees Celsius to allow the heaters to reach operational temperature within the standard 15-minute warm-up period. A bathroom, utility room, bedroom, or dedicated wellness room are all suitable locations provided the floor can bear the unit weight of approximately 120 kg for a single-person model. What timber is used to build the infrared sauna Glasgow?

Every infrared sauna Glasgow unit from Gravity Wellness is constructed exclusively from PEFC-certified Canadian hemlock — widely regarded as the premier timber for sauna construction in the UK and Europe. Canadian hemlock has a naturally low resin content, which prevents the surface from becoming sticky at elevated temperatures, and it carries inherent antimicrobial properties that resist bacteria and mould growth between sessions. Its straight, tight grain provides outstanding dimensional stability under repeated cycles of heat and humidity, ensuring your cabin remains structurally sound and visually beautiful for many years of regular use.
